I got a call from these people stating that they would arrest my husband within an hour if I did not send them $499.80.  I contacted my lawyer and they were told to fax them some information.  After they received the fax Ms. Spillman was suppose to call the lawyer's office back.  After checking today, I found out they have not received a call back from Ms. Spillman.  Also, on Friday, 9/19/08, I contacted the Arkansas Attorney General's Office and the lady told me to definitely file a complaint with the state.  I did so on line and am waiting on an answer from the Attorney General's office.  This is definitely a scam.  DO NOT SEND THESE PEOPLE MONEY!!!!!!!!

Government Actions

Per a January 25, 2007 press release, Illinois Attorney General's Lisa Madigan's has filed a lawsuit against Arrow Financial Services for allegations that debt collectors used unfair tactics and deceptive practices to collect money from consumers.

Madigan's lawsuit charges Arrow with multiple violations of the Illinois Consumer Fraud and Deceptive Business Practices Act. The suit specifically alleges that Arrow attempts to collect on time-barred debts over ten years old, attempts to collect on debts that have been discharged in bankruptcy or that have been settled, engages in abusive practices in an attempt to collect, such as using profanity, attempts to obtain payment without proof of debt, refuses or fails to provide proof of debt, illegally contacts consumers' family members and workplace, and withdraws money without authorization from consumers' bank accounts.

Madigan's lawsuit asks the court to prohibit Arrow from engaging in deceptive debt collection activities and further violating Illinois' consumer protection laws. The lawsuit seeks a civil penalty of $50,000 and additional penalties of $50,000 for each violation found to have been committed with intent to defraud. Finally, Madigan's lawsuit asks the court to order Arrow to pay restitution to consumers and to pay all costs for prosecution and investigation of this case

ISERT TAKEN FROM BBB WEBSIGHT

I received a crazy call from a lady name Ms Callaway regarding a payday loan from Sept of 06.  She treatened me by saying since I made the loan over my work computer that I had violated some laws and that someone will be up at my job to take my work computer for evidence and take me to jail also.  I was falling for this until I decided to call the magaistrate office and they told me you cannot go to jail over a civil matter and they cannot come to your job.  I called Ms Callaway back from Spellman & Roman and told her I was not able to come up with the money and she said they will proceed with the proper steps.  I told her nicely that there was just nothing I could do and that I have talked with the court office and they told me some things I wish not to share with her.  She said she hopes everything work out and hung up the phone.  It has been 3 hours now and no one has come up to my job to lock me up.  I do believe this is a scam and people please do not fall for it.  They will tell you all this stuff over the phone but if you know you did not commit any crime then do not let them get to your head.
